/external/llvm/lib/Target/Sparc/ |
D | SparcMachineFunctionInfo.h | 23 unsigned GlobalBaseReg; 33 : GlobalBaseReg(0), VarArgsFrameOffset(0), SRetReturnReg(0) {} in SparcMachineFunctionInfo() 35 : GlobalBaseReg(0), VarArgsFrameOffset(0), SRetReturnReg(0) {} in SparcMachineFunctionInfo() 37 unsigned getGlobalBaseReg() const { return GlobalBaseReg; } in getGlobalBaseReg() 38 void setGlobalBaseReg(unsigned Reg) { GlobalBaseReg = Reg; } in setGlobalBaseReg()
|
D | SparcInstrInfo.cpp | 340 unsigned GlobalBaseReg = SparcFI->getGlobalBaseReg(); in getGlobalBaseReg() local 341 if (GlobalBaseReg != 0) in getGlobalBaseReg() 342 return GlobalBaseReg; in getGlobalBaseReg() 349 GlobalBaseReg = RegInfo.createVirtualRegister(&SP::IntRegsRegClass); in getGlobalBaseReg() 354 BuildMI(FirstMBB, MBBI, dl, get(SP::GETPCX), GlobalBaseReg); in getGlobalBaseReg() 355 SparcFI->setGlobalBaseReg(GlobalBaseReg); in getGlobalBaseReg() 356 return GlobalBaseReg; in getGlobalBaseReg()
|
D | SparcISelDAGToDAG.cpp | 69 unsigned GlobalBaseReg = TM.getInstrInfo()->getGlobalBaseReg(MF); in getGlobalBaseReg() local 70 return CurDAG->getRegister(GlobalBaseReg, TLI.getPointerTy()).getNode(); in getGlobalBaseReg()
|
/external/llvm/lib/Target/X86/ |
D | X86MachineFunctionInfo.h | 56 unsigned GlobalBaseReg; variable 79 GlobalBaseReg(0), in X86MachineFunctionInfo() 94 GlobalBaseReg(0), in X86MachineFunctionInfo() 120 unsigned getGlobalBaseReg() const { return GlobalBaseReg; } in getGlobalBaseReg() 121 void setGlobalBaseReg(unsigned Reg) { GlobalBaseReg = Reg; } in setGlobalBaseReg()
|
D | X86InstrBuilder.h | 175 unsigned GlobalBaseReg, unsigned char OpFlags) { in addConstantPoolReference() argument 177 return MIB.addReg(GlobalBaseReg).addImm(1).addReg(0) in addConstantPoolReference()
|
D | X86ISelLowering.h | 130 GlobalBaseReg, enumerator
|
D | X86InstrInfo.cpp | 4533 unsigned GlobalBaseReg = X86FI->getGlobalBaseReg(); in getGlobalBaseReg() local 4534 if (GlobalBaseReg != 0) in getGlobalBaseReg() 4535 return GlobalBaseReg; in getGlobalBaseReg() 4540 GlobalBaseReg = RegInfo.createVirtualRegister(&X86::GR32_NOSPRegClass); in getGlobalBaseReg() 4541 X86FI->setGlobalBaseReg(GlobalBaseReg); in getGlobalBaseReg() 4542 return GlobalBaseReg; in getGlobalBaseReg() 4727 unsigned GlobalBaseReg = X86FI->getGlobalBaseReg(); in runOnMachineFunction() local 4730 if (GlobalBaseReg == 0) in runOnMachineFunction() 4744 PC = GlobalBaseReg; in runOnMachineFunction() 4754 BuildMI(FirstMBB, MBBI, DL, TII->get(X86::ADD32ri), GlobalBaseReg) in runOnMachineFunction()
|
D | X86ISelDAGToDAG.cpp | 1487 unsigned GlobalBaseReg = getInstrInfo()->getGlobalBaseReg(MF); in getGlobalBaseReg() local 1488 return CurDAG->getRegister(GlobalBaseReg, TLI.getPointerTy()).getNode(); in getGlobalBaseReg() 2047 case X86ISD::GlobalBaseReg: in Select()
|
D | X86ISelLowering.cpp | 1512 return DAG.getNode(X86ISD::GlobalBaseReg, DebugLoc(), getPointerTy()); in getPICJumpTableRelocBase() 2444 DAG.getNode(X86ISD::GlobalBaseReg, DebugLoc(), getPointerTy()))); in LowerCall() 7451 DAG.getNode(X86ISD::GlobalBaseReg, in LowerConstantPool() 7484 DAG.getNode(X86ISD::GlobalBaseReg, in LowerJumpTable() 7523 DAG.getNode(X86ISD::GlobalBaseReg, in LowerExternalSymbol() 7558 DAG.getNode(X86ISD::GlobalBaseReg, dl, getPointerTy()), in LowerBlockAddress() 7592 DAG.getNode(X86ISD::GlobalBaseReg, dl, getPointerTy()), in LowerGlobalAddress() 7655 DAG.getNode(X86ISD::GlobalBaseReg, in LowerToTLSGeneralDynamicModel32() 7688 DAG.getNode(X86ISD::GlobalBaseReg, DebugLoc(), PtrVT), InFlag); in LowerToTLSLocalDynamicModel() 7752 DAG.getNode(X86ISD::GlobalBaseReg, DebugLoc(), PtrVT), in LowerToTLSExecModel() [all …]
|
/external/llvm/lib/Target/Mips/ |
D | MipsMachineFunction.cpp | 26 return GlobalBaseReg; in globalBaseRegSet() 31 if (GlobalBaseReg) in getGlobalBaseReg() 32 return GlobalBaseReg; in getGlobalBaseReg() 43 return GlobalBaseReg = MF.getRegInfo().createVirtualRegister(RC); in getGlobalBaseReg()
|
D | MipsMachineFunction.h | 40 unsigned GlobalBaseReg; variable 64 : MF(MF), SRetReturnReg(0), GlobalBaseReg(0), Mips16SPAliasReg(0), in MipsFunctionInfo()
|
D | MipsISelDAGToDAG.cpp | 60 unsigned GlobalBaseReg = MF->getInfo<MipsFunctionInfo>()->getGlobalBaseReg(); in getGlobalBaseReg() local 61 return CurDAG->getRegister(GlobalBaseReg, TLI.getPointerTy()).getNode(); in getGlobalBaseReg()
|
D | MipsSEISelDAGToDAG.cpp | 88 unsigned V0, V1, GlobalBaseReg = MipsFI->getGlobalBaseReg(); in initGlobalBaseReg() local 111 BuildMI(MBB, I, DL, TII.get(Mips::DADDiu), GlobalBaseReg).addReg(V1) in initGlobalBaseReg() 123 BuildMI(MBB, I, DL, TII.get(Mips::ADDiu), GlobalBaseReg).addReg(V0) in initGlobalBaseReg() 139 BuildMI(MBB, I, DL, TII.get(Mips::ADDiu), GlobalBaseReg).addReg(V1) in initGlobalBaseReg() 165 BuildMI(MBB, I, DL, TII.get(Mips::ADDu), GlobalBaseReg) in initGlobalBaseReg()
|
D | Mips16ISelDAGToDAG.cpp | 70 unsigned V0, V1, V2, GlobalBaseReg = MipsFI->getGlobalBaseReg(); in initGlobalBaseReg() local 83 BuildMI(MBB, I, DL, TII.get(Mips::AdduRxRyRz16), GlobalBaseReg) in initGlobalBaseReg()
|
/external/llvm/lib/Target/ARM/ |
D | ARMMachineFunctionInfo.h | 114 unsigned GlobalBaseReg; variable 127 VarArgsFrameIndex(0), HasITBlocks(false), GlobalBaseReg(0) {} in ARMFunctionInfo() 138 VarArgsFrameIndex(0), HasITBlocks(false), GlobalBaseReg(0) {} in ARMFunctionInfo() 257 unsigned getGlobalBaseReg() const { return GlobalBaseReg; } in getGlobalBaseReg() 258 void setGlobalBaseReg(unsigned Reg) { GlobalBaseReg = Reg; } in setGlobalBaseReg()
|
D | ARMInstrInfo.cpp | 121 unsigned GlobalBaseReg = AFI->getGlobalBaseReg(); in runOnMachineFunction() local 126 TII.get(Opc), GlobalBaseReg) in runOnMachineFunction()
|
D | ARMFastISel.cpp | 2869 unsigned GlobalBaseReg = AFI->getGlobalBaseReg(); in ARMLowerPICELF() local 2870 if (GlobalBaseReg == 0) { in ARMLowerPICELF() 2871 GlobalBaseReg = MRI.createVirtualRegister(TLI.getRegClassFor(VT)); in ARMLowerPICELF() 2872 AFI->setGlobalBaseReg(GlobalBaseReg); in ARMLowerPICELF() 2879 .addReg(GlobalBaseReg); in ARMLowerPICELF()
|
/external/llvm/lib/Target/MBlaze/ |
D | MBlazeMachineFunction.h | 79 unsigned GlobalBaseReg; variable 91 HasStoreVarArgs(false), SRetReturnReg(0), GlobalBaseReg(0), in MBlazeFunctionInfo() 160 unsigned getGlobalBaseReg() const { return GlobalBaseReg; } in getGlobalBaseReg() 161 void setGlobalBaseReg(unsigned Reg) { GlobalBaseReg = Reg; } in setGlobalBaseReg()
|
D | MBlazeInstrInfo.cpp | 280 unsigned GlobalBaseReg = MBlazeFI->getGlobalBaseReg(); in getGlobalBaseReg() local 281 if (GlobalBaseReg != 0) in getGlobalBaseReg() 282 return GlobalBaseReg; in getGlobalBaseReg() 290 GlobalBaseReg = RegInfo.createVirtualRegister(&MBlaze::GPRRegClass); in getGlobalBaseReg() 292 GlobalBaseReg).addReg(MBlaze::R20); in getGlobalBaseReg() 295 MBlazeFI->setGlobalBaseReg(GlobalBaseReg); in getGlobalBaseReg() 296 return GlobalBaseReg; in getGlobalBaseReg()
|
D | MBlazeISelDAGToDAG.cpp | 183 unsigned GlobalBaseReg = getInstrInfo()->getGlobalBaseReg(MF); in getGlobalBaseReg() local 184 return CurDAG->getRegister(GlobalBaseReg, TLI.getPointerTy()).getNode(); in getGlobalBaseReg()
|
/external/llvm/lib/Target/PowerPC/ |
D | PPCISelDAGToDAG.cpp | 50 unsigned GlobalBaseReg; member in __anone58458c80111::PPCDAGToDAGISel 61 GlobalBaseReg = 0; in runOnMachineFunction() 262 if (!GlobalBaseReg) { in getGlobalBaseReg() 270 GlobalBaseReg = RegInfo->createVirtualRegister(&PPC::GPRCRegClass); in getGlobalBaseReg() 272 BuildMI(FirstMBB, MBBI, dl, TII.get(PPC::MFLR), GlobalBaseReg); in getGlobalBaseReg() 274 GlobalBaseReg = RegInfo->createVirtualRegister(&PPC::G8RCRegClass); in getGlobalBaseReg() 276 BuildMI(FirstMBB, MBBI, dl, TII.get(PPC::MFLR8), GlobalBaseReg); in getGlobalBaseReg() 279 return CurDAG->getRegister(GlobalBaseReg, in getGlobalBaseReg() 987 case PPCISD::GlobalBaseReg: in Select()
|
D | PPCISelLowering.h | 86 GlobalBaseReg, enumerator
|
D | PPCISelLowering.cpp | 556 case PPCISD::GlobalBaseReg: return "PPCISD::GlobalBaseReg"; in getTargetNodeName() 1282 DAG.getNode(PPCISD::GlobalBaseReg, DL, PtrVT), Hi); in LowerLabelRef()
|